Webbsmaller chunksの文脈に沿ったReverso Contextの英語-日本語の翻訳: 例文These were considered the height of coolness in the mid to late 90s, and there was evidence that … WebbMemory fragmentation is when most of your memory is allocated in a large number of non-contiguous blocks, or chunks - leaving a good percentage of your total memory unallocated, but unusable for most typical scenarios. This results in out of memory exceptions, or allocation errors (i.e. malloc returns null).
